 WEST DES MOINES, Iowa — Dubai Chocolate Bars are now sold in select Hy-Vee stores across the grocer’s eight-state region. Hy-Vee is one of the few grocery retailers in the U.S. to offer this popular product that’s become a hit on social media.

The Dubai Chocolate Bar trend went viral a few months ago, after several food influencers raved about the new confection on social media platforms. From there, the Dubai Chocolate Bar became an instant sensation, with demand growing faster than supply.

The candy bar is inspired by knafeh, a Middle Eastern dessert made with kataifi, sweet attar syrup, and layers of pistachio and cream. The inside of the chocolate bar is a mixture of crispy knafeh bits and pistachio cream. The bar's exterior stands out with its hand-splatter-painted design in vibrant yellow and green colors.

“Hy-Vee is thrilled to bring this trending item to our customers,” said Matt Beenblossom, president of Lomar, Hy-Vee's specialty foods subsidiary. “Thanks to our team, we are able to source and bring these types of popular products that our customers see all over social media right to our local Hy-Vee stores.”

The combination of the unique flavors and textures, coupled with the visual appeal of the chocolate bar, has led to the sweet treat’s popularity in the United States.
